At least four districts in Mymensingh division were hit with a power outage after a national grid substation in Kewatkhali caught fire again on Thursday morning.

The fire broke out at the 132/33 KV grid substation this morning. Several units of firefighters rushed the spot and are trying to douse the fire, Fire Service sources said.

Earlier on September 8, a fire at Mymensingh city's Kewatkhali Power Grid snapped power supply in the entire Mymensingh division for several hours.
